A karst area is one generally characterized by numerous caves, sinkholes, springs, and little surface drainage. It is a dry, upland landscape with underground drainage instead of surface streams. Shilin is part of a larger karst landscape called the South China Karst, which spreads across the Chinese provinces of Guangxi, Guizhou, and Yunnan. This is made possible by the carbon dioxide absorbed by rainwater as it passes through the atmosphere, forming a weak carbonic acid solution (H 2 CO 3).
